
Obituary of Allan Lewis Stewart
Peacefully at Lanark Lodge on November 30, 2025, Allan passed away at the age of 87. He was the beloved husband of Joyce (nee Bell) for 59 years. Allan was the proud father of Barbara (Jeff Dyer), Brenda (Peter Nordheimer) and Bradley (Lori) Stewart, and the dear grandfather of Cory (Brittany) Dyer, Owen (Shannon) Dyer, Jaclyn Stewart and Charlotte Stewart, great-grandfather of Ben, Jack and Olivia Dyer. Allan will be fondly remembered by his siblings Gordon (Kathleen) Stewart, Margaret Inwood and Helen Halpenny, his sister-in-law Beulah Stewart and brother-in-law Murray (Marilyn) Bell. He was predeceased by his brother Donald and sister Evelyn Knowles. He will be sadly missed by his long-term friend Alma Morris along with many nieces, nephews, extended family and friends.
Allan’s greatest love was his family and his farm at Pine Grove (Lanark) which involved dairy and later a beef herd. His two favourite jobs were cutting the hay and plowing the land. His main hobby was playing the fiddle and being involved in musical gatherings where he made many friends.
The family wishes to thank the wonderful, caring staff at Lanark Lodge, Maples Unit where Allan spent almost seven years dealing with dementia. Special thanks to Lloyd Wilson for playing hours of fiddle music to Allan at the Lodge.
